On 11/22/2010 12:41 PM, David Cemin wrote: 
And I am having the same mac on peth0 and eth0 .. where do I configure 
it .. inside xend-config.sxp ? 
 
Thank you again 
 
 
peth0 and eth0 do share a MAC address, that is okay (as they are one in the same). The domU machines though all need unique MAC addresses. You should use '00:16:3e:xx:xx:xx'.
